Which religion is more in West Bengal?

Hinduism is the major religion of West Bengal with about 70.54% people responded that they were Hindus during the 2011 Census of India. Out of a total of 91.3 million people in the state, the Hindu population is approximately 64.5 million.

When did Islam came to Bengal?

Starting in the 9th century, Muslim merchants increased trade with Bengali seaports. Islam first appeared in Bengal during Pala rule, as a result of increased trade between Bengal and the Arab Abbasid Caliphate. Coins of the Abbasid Caliphate have been discovered in many parts of the region.

How many Bengalis are in UK?

500,000 Bengalis
There are approximately 500,000 Bengalis currently living in the UK. Not much history of those Bengalis who settled in the UK currently exists (except two books written by Caroline Adams & Yousuf Chowdhury).

How many Bangladeshis are in America?

Bangladeshi Americans are one of the fastest growing Asian origin groups in the United States with their number surging 263 percent over the past two decades from just 57,000 in 2000 to 208,000 in 2019, according to US Census Bureau data.
